Sadistic personality disorder and psychopathy are strongly correlated with violent behavior.

Multiple studies substantiate the link between psychopathic traits, sadistic tendencies, and various forms of aggressive, coercive, and violent behavior.

Psychopathic Traits and Attitudes Associated With Self-Reported Sexual Aggression in College Men
1998 · cited by 37
This paper demonstrates that psychopathic personality traits are associated with self-reported sexual aggression in men.
Anger Experience, Styles of Anger Expression, Sadistic Personality Disorder, and Psychopathy in Juvenile Sexual Homicide Offenders
2000 · cited by 24
This study evaluates juvenile offenders and links sadistic personality and psychopathy to violent forensic outcomes.
Psychopathic Traits and Sexual Coercion Against Relationship Partners in Men and Women
2018 · cited by 14
This research connects psychopathic trait facets to sexual coercion and intimate partner violence perpetration.
Sadism and Personality Disorders.
2023 · cited by 5
This review highlights that sadism is most strongly related to increased psychopathic traits and harmful interpersonal behaviors.
Dark Tetrad personality traits, paraphilic interests, and the role of impulsivity: an EEG-study using a Go/No-Go paradigm.
2024 · cited by 2
This study indicates that psychopathy and sadism are positively associated with paraphilic interests and related behaviors.
